設計網(wǎng)站的網(wǎng)站源代碼涉及多個(gè)層面的技術(shù)組合,以下是代碼代碼關(guān)鍵要素和實(shí)現步驟的總結:
一、核心技術(shù)組成
HTML
負責構建網(wǎng)??頁(yè)結構,生成包括標題、器設段落、計網(wǎng)??鏈接、網(wǎng)站圖像等基礎元素。代碼代碼
CSS
通過(guò)層疊樣式表控制網(wǎng)頁(yè)樣式,生成如字體、器設顏色、計網(wǎng)間距等,網(wǎng)站實(shí)現布局和視覺(jué)效果。代碼代碼
JavaScript
實(shí)現網(wǎng)頁(yè)交互功能,生成如表單驗證、器設動(dòng)態(tài)效果(輪播圖、計網(wǎng)響應式布局)等。
處理數據庫交互(CRUD操作)、用戶(hù)認證等后端邏輯。
數據庫(如Access、MySQL)
存儲和管理數據,支持動(dòng)態(tài)網(wǎng)頁(yè)內容更新。
二、開(kāi)發(fā)流程與工具
代碼結構組織
使用MVC(模型-視圖-控制器)架構提升可維護性。
模塊化開(kāi)發(fā):將CSS、JavaScript按功能拆分。
開(kāi)發(fā)工具
文本編輯器(如VS Code、Sublime Text)。
集成開(kāi)發(fā)環(huán)境(IDE)如WebStorm、(O_O)PyCharm。
版本控制工?具(如Git)。
響應式設計
使用CSS媒體查詢(xún)實(shí)現多設備適配,例如:
```css
@media (max-width: 600px) {
.container {
width: 100%;
}
}
```ヾ(′▽?zhuān)??
動(dòng)態(tài)效果與交互
使用J??avaScript實(shí)現表單驗證:
```javascript
function validatヾ(′▽?zhuān)??eForm() {
var name = document.getElementById('name'(′ω`)).val(′ω`*)ue;
if (nヽ(′▽?zhuān)?ノame === '') {
alert('請填寫(xiě)姓名');
return false;
}
}
```
利(li)用CSS3動(dòng)畫(huà)或JavaScript庫(如jQue(//ω//)ry)增強用戶(hù)體驗。
三、典型代碼示例
```html
用戶(hù)登錄


網(wǎng)站二維碼
導航
電話(huà)
短信
咨詢(xún)
地圖
分享